Musculoskeletal Ultrasound is a dynamic, non-invasive exam that allows high-resolution, real-time evaluation of musculoskeletal disorders. It is an excellent complement to Magnetic Resonance Imaging (MRI) and a reliable modality for diagnosing soſt tissue musculoskeletal disorders such as ligament and tendon injury/damage. Common exams include diagnostic evaluation of the shoulder, ankle/foot, elbow, hip, knee, wrist/hand. While MRI remains the gold standard for diagnosing soſt tissue injury, ultrasound can be comparable for many diagnoses and can be utilized in patients with contraindications for MRI.
